About Romeo

Romeo is a Statutory Town in Conejos County, Colorado, United States. The 2020 census counted 302 residents. A post office called Romeo was established in 1901. The community derives its name from the surname Romero. The through line in Romeo is the way its history and present-day settings remain visible on the same map. Romeo is located in east-central Conejos County in the San Luis Valley region. U.S. Route 285 runs along the western border of the town, leading north 21 miles to Alamosa and south 12 miles to the New Mexico border and beyond.
